HamadaElewa - PeerSpot reviewer
An expensive solution to monitor internet traffic with multiple dashboards
The huge library especially the open source link, makes it the main engine for Corelight with some enhancements in the commercial version. It has a very powerful level, such as signature-based attacks or behavioral attacks, with enhancements in the design. It is very flexible for intelligent implementations like IPs, especially between big companies and banks. Corelight is easy to understand and monitor what is going on behind the team. The solution is already integrated with other systems like Suricata, Elastic, and Microsoft tools. It's very easy to integrate signature-based or behavior-based engines. You can use Elastic for the dashboards to get it from Corelight, along with all the benefits and expandability.
TAIYAB HASAN - PeerSpot reviewer
Has improved network visibility and security through micro-segmentation and SDN capabilities
This feature gives us flexibility and allows us to manage everything under one pane. We can see everything on one console, including network operations and behavior. Monitoring and security are among the best features for VMware NSX. For micro-segmentation, it's integrated with our endpoint security. If there are any issues with servers or VMs, it notifies us so we can isolate the servers and investigate. It provides distributed security features such as firewall and intrusion, IDS, IPS. The security level with IPS and IDS in VMware NSX is excellent. It also provides logical switching and routing which gives an extra layer for Layer 2 and Layer 3 switching requirements. The solution provides flexibility, automation, and self-service capabilities, resulting in cost savings as extensive expertise isn't required. Once automation and self-service are implemented, many tasks can be completed automatically. Load balancing is another excellent feature. Multiple servers can run on load balancing features, which is particularly useful since we have many application servers running. Sharing loads between servers provides the best performance.
